Three Year B.Sc. in H & HA

The Bachelor of Science program in Hospitality and Hotel Administration is offered jointly by the NCHM&CT and the degree will be awarded by Jawahar Lal Nehru University (JNU), New Delhi. The Three Years (Six Semesters) full time regular course equips students with all the required skills, knowledge and attitude to efficiently discharge supervisory responsibilities in the Hospitality Sector. The program also involves in-depth laboratory work for students to acquire required knowledge and skill standards for the operational area.

            All graduates are employed by Hospitality and other service sectors through on-campus and off-campus recruitment process.

Intake: 120 seats

Educational Qualification: 10+2 or equivalent examination passed.

Admission: 3 years B.Sc. in Hospitality & Hoteel Administration programme through Joint Entrance Examination conducted by National Council for Hotel Management, Noida. The admission notice is issued every year in the month of December/January. The written examination is conducted in April/ May and counseling is normally held in June. Admission is strictly based on the All India Rank (AIR) earned by the candidate in written test by JEE-NTA. Candidates are advised to further refer the website of www.nchm.nic.in. or www.nta.ac.in. The session commences from July.

Age Limit: Minimum 17 years, No upper age limit.

Reservation: As per the norms of the State Government.

Scholarship: As per the Norms of Central/State Government.

Food Production is the heart of Hoteliering and Catering. The work is of a practical and creative in nature. While small hotels employ apprentice cooks, assistant cooks and cooks, larger establishments provide for chef-de-cuisine. A head Chef controls this important department with large complement of staff and is required to be both a skilled practitioner and an able organizer. Good chefs command high salaries and are among the highest paid professionals in the industry
